I was wondering when you guys are volume Bending how long you wait in between bends???

Right now i am waiting about 2 minutes whsich dosent seem right??

It depends on the relative difficulty. If I'm doing relatively easy bends, I'll go back to back. My highest volume for speed is 50 TT's all back to back. If the bends are a little tougher, I might wait 15-30 seconds between bends. For me, volume is about speed and form.

If you have only been bending a month or so that is very good progress but take some time and avoid injury. That is good volume for starting out but would be more of a "tough" workout than a "volume" workout. In a few days you might try to get 20 bends with only 30s between bends or something like that. I would go easy TT or HRS. Work the form. I think the volume early on is important to help condition the tissues for harder bends.
